Through drama and heartache, the two reconcile and babies are born into a happy marriage, some of them through the epilogues of other books. In time, Daphne realizes that Simon hasn’t been truthful with her and feels betrayed by what she realizes are his deliberate efforts to mislead her and avoid conception. When innocent Daphne’s mother, Violet, explains sex to her, she’s left confused at the mechanics and goes into marriage blind. Simon informs Daphne that he can’t have children and she accepts him regardless. Through Regency era shenanigans, Simon and Daphne find themselves forced to marry, despite their differing plans for life.

Unsurprisingly, this doesn’t go as planned and the two begin to truly fall in love. Mothers eager to marry their daughters will leave the disinterested, yet extremely eligible, Simon alone and Daphne will attract the attention of far better suitors when they see she’s caught the eye of a Duke. Regardless, Simon and Daphne hatch a plan to convince high society, or the ton, that they’re courting. Before he can save the day, Daphne punches the drunk herself and Simon finds himself immediately attracted to her… that is until he discovers that she’s the little sister of his best friend. Simon first meets Daphne when she’s being harassed by a suitor. Meanwhile, Daphne longs for marriage and motherhood, but finds that she’s so easy to get along with that men tend to see her as a strictly friendly or even sisterly companion, much to her despair during her first season on the marriage market. Having been abused by his own father, Simon has vowed never to marry or have children. Simon is a rake (Regency era playboy) and the best friend of Anthony Bridgerton, Daphne’s oldest brother. The Duke and I tells the tale of Simon Basset, the Duke of Hastings, and Daphne, the oldest Bridgerton daughter in the summer of 1813.

If you’re unfamiliar with the premise and have perhaps just had it on your Netflix list, it’s about a family of eight children, the Bridgertons, sequentially named for the first eight letters of the alphabet and their adventures in love. Bridgerton, however, is one of the rare shows that seems to have gained household notoriety, even if not everyone has actually watched it. While others lament that fact, I’m just relieved that finally, I can rewatch the original Roswell for the 87th time in peace, without being subjected to the absolute horror that I haven’t seen Yellowstone. In our modern world, where everyone is watching something different, there are few titles that everyone recognizes. So, as a balm to my somewhat raw senses, I decided to try a modern and lighthearted take on classics, with Julia Quinn’s Bridgerton series, following the prolific family of the same name in Regency era Britain, which officially spans the years 1811-1820. Reading a classic is enjoyable in the way reading a PEW Research Center study is enjoyable. The pacing is far slower, the world-building is more involved, the themes are less obvious, and in many cases, the dialect can be quite difficult to follow. While I genuinely enjoyed all but two of the titles I chose, I realized that there’s a reason why people don’t typically read classics for fun. Once I completed my self-assigned project to read 26 classics, I was pretty burnt out on heavy literature.
